The Slow Readers Club have announced PINS and Liines as supports for their headline Manchester gig at the O2 Apollo.

The announcement comes as the band unveil a new remix of Supernatural by Enter Shikari.  Speaking about the remix The Slow Readers Club frontman Aaron Starkie says, “We’re keen to start exploring remixes a bit more, so it’s been great to hear Shikari Sound System’s take on the track. It’s cool getting a new perspective on our stuff and at the same time get the music get our there to new people.”

Supernatural is the latest single to be taken from The Slow Readers Club’s new album Build A Tower, which entered the album charts at number 18, 10 in the physical album chart, 4 in the vinyl chart, 4 in the indie album chart and number 1 in the cassette chart.

Enter Shikari’s frontman Rou Reynolds commented on the remix, “I’ve been a fan of The Slow Readers Club for a while now. Their melodies, song craftsmanship and passion are inspiring. It was great to be able to get my hands on one of their tracks and give it the Shikari Sound System twist.”
